Overview
The Sudan Sticker Visa is a conventional visa that is applied as a sticker on a traveler's passport and permits entry into Sudan for official visits, business trips, or tourism. Before entering the nation, candidates must apply through a Sudanese embassy or consulate and provide the necessary paperwork.

1.Is a transit visa required for Sudan?
If you are transiting through Khartoum Airport and staying in the international transit area, a transit visa may not be required. However, if you need to leave the airport or have a long layover, a transit visa or short-stay visa is needed.
2.Is travel insurance required for a Sudan visa?
While not mandatory, travel insurance is strongly recommended, especially due to limited healthcare infrastructure and the risk of travel disruptions.
3.Does applying require an invitation letter?
It is true that many applicants must provide an invitation letter or sponsor information from Sudan.
4. Does entering Sudan require vaccination?
Depending on their past travel experiences, travelers may be required to present a Yellow Fever vaccination certificate.
